Embodiments of the present disclosure disclose a massaging device. The massaging device includes a first stimulating member and a second stimulating member. The second stimulating member includes a drive member. The drive member includes a first arm configured with a retainer member and a second arm. The retainer member is secured to a first limiting member of the first stimulating member to couple the first stimulating member and the second stimulating member. Further, the massaging device includes an actuator positioned in the second stimulating member and operatively coupled to the drive member. The actuator is configured to induce a rotary motion to the drive member for operating at least the first stimulating member and the second stimulating member in a plurality of stimulation modes. The first and second stimulating members operable in the plurality of stimulation modes induce sexual stimulation to the erogenous zones of a user.
